Diagnosing Broken Seat Track Issues
Diagnosing a broken seat track mechanism in a Mercedes massage seat involves careful inspection and an understanding of the vehicle’s intricate design. The first step is to identify the specific model and year of the Mercedes, as different generations have unique seat mechanisms. A visual examination can reveal signs such as loose or missing parts, misaligned tracks, or visible damage from a fender bender or vehicle collision repair. Check for any unusual noises or lack of smooth movement when adjusting the seat position, indicating potential issues with the track mechanism.
Automotive repair specialists often begin by removing the seat to access and assess the track system. They may use specialized tools to disassemble and inspect each component, looking for wear, damage, or misalignment. This meticulous process helps in identifying the root cause of the problem, whether it’s a simple part replacement or a more complex repair, ensuring the comfort and safety of the vehicle’s occupants.
Step-by-Step Repair Guide for Memory Seats
Repairing Mercedes memory seats that have a broken seat track mechanism can be a straightforward process if approached systematically. Begin by ensuring proper tools are available, including a seat track removal tool, a new track assembly, and any necessary lubricants or replacement parts for the sliding rails. Next, locate the seat tracks on both sides of the seat, typically secured with plastic clips or fasteners. Remove these securely to gain access to the interior of the car.
With the seat tracks exposed, carefully inspect them for damage or wear. Clean the area thoroughly to eliminate any debris that might hinder the new track’s smooth operation. Once prepared, install the new track assembly, ensuring it aligns perfectly with the vehicle’s frame. Reattach all fasteners securely and lubricate the sliding rails as per manufacturer recommendations. Finally, test the seat’s functionality, confirming the memory settings are retained and the seat moves smoothly along both axes—a testament to successful Mercedes massage seat repair.
